All of the Barrhaven Girls Basketball Association coaches and administrators are volunteers.

All coaches not having accredited teaching or coaching degrees, or having completed minimum coaching classes, have two years to successfully complete the National Coaching Certification Program (NCCP) or equivalents approved by the executive.

Assistants are needed and are welcome from volunteer ranks and motivated parents, which can provide experience and qualifications to direct and coach a future team.

The BGBA offers financial assistance and technical support for its novice (and experienced) coaches. NCCP clinics will take a novice coach through the basic skills and drills, practice planning, and basketball rules.

Upon agreeing to coach in the BGBA, all coaches agree to abide by the Basketball Ontario Coaches Conduct.
